The main heroes
The main hero of this story is Charlotte (goes by Charlie). She grew up with her Aunt Jen, who taught her to be independent and self-sufficient. Throughout the book, Charlie becomes more and more determined to know the answers to the mysteries of her haunted past, clinging to the few memories of her childhood that have remained with her.
Even though Charlie finds it difficult to open up to others, she values ​​her friends and the connection they share.

I don’t like the main character of this story because she is boring and sometimes it seems like she doesn’t have a personality and she’s acting like a robot (which makes sense in the second book because the plot twist there is that she IS a robot)
